With the Joint Agreements solution, you can grant another eSignature account access to specific documents in an envelope. Creating a joint agreement is similar to creating an envelope, you add your documents, recipients, and fields. However, with the joint agreement transaction, you can also include documents provided by another party, also called a network partner. The documents can include additional terms and requirements as defined by your network partner. Your recipients can sign all the documents in a single signing session. When the joint agreement transaction is completed, the network partner automatically receives an email notification with a link to review the documents. They can only view the documents you granted them access to. To get started sending joint agreements, you first need to open an invitation link to join your partners network. In case a promissory note is not paid it is deemed dishonoured and the original debt amount is yet payable. A new promissory note can be drawn upon the payer depending on the repayment position or the bill maker can take the payee to court. Also read: What Is Promissory Note?
The lender can then take the promissory note to a financial institution (usually a bank, albeit this could also be a private person, or another company), that will exchange the promissory note for cash; usually, the promissory note is cashed in for the amount established in the promissory note, less a small discount.
A form of debt instrument, a promissory note represents a written promise on the part of the issuer to pay back another party. A promissory note will include the agreed-upon terms between the two parties, such as the maturity date, principal, interest, and issuers signature.
It is the maker who is primarily liable on a promissory note. The issuer of a note or the maker is one of the parties who, by means of a written promise, pay another party (the notes payee) a definite sum of money, either on-demand or at a specified future date.
